Le Shrimp Ramen revamped
Le Shrimp Ramen at South Coast Plaza’s Collage has recently revised its broth recipe for ramen. When the restaurant first launch, the original broth was a combination of shrimp and pork. The new recipe sees pork eliminated and replaced with chicken. This, in my opinion, is a far better choice as it allows for diners […]
